Question 5 A rectangular piece of metal has length twice the width Suppose squares with sides 4 in long are cut from the four corners and the flaps are folded upward to form an open box If the volume of the box is 1536 in what were the original dimensions of the piece of metal Hint Volume of a box Length x Width x Height
